		<description><![CDATA[The Council of Europe Commissioner for Human Rights, Thomas Hammarberg, will carry out a visit to Moldova from 25 to 28 April to assess the human rights situation following the recent post-electoral events, CE press office says.

Spain in 2005 &#171;normalised&#187; 600,000 irregular migrants. 	The move stopped short of granting EU citizenship but did give 	permanent residency and right to work, with Madrid at the time 	facing strong criticism for failing to consult EU colleagues.

EU states in any case collectively naturalise over 730,000 	people a year in what amounts to an annual mini-enlargement, bigger 	in scale than the individual populations of the smallest member 	states, Malta and Luxembourg.

EUOBSERVER / BRUSSELS &#8212; EU institutions are appalled at 	Romania&#8217;s proposal to give citizenship to up to 1 million Moldovans 	- a project that could damage Romania&#8217;s standing inside the union.
